About the Colors in Tattoos

Some colors of tattoos are harder to remove than others; professional tattoos are usually harder to remove than amateur tattoos.

It is much easier to have a small tattoo removed than a big one. The risk of scarring is always present. Both getting a tattoo and having it removed can be uncomfortable. The impact of the energy from the laser’s powerful pulse of light has been described as similar to getting hot specks of bacon grease on your skin or being snapped by a thin rubber band.

Because black pigment absorbs all laser wavelengths, it’s the easiest to remove. Other colors, such as green, selectively absorb laser light and can only be treated by selected lasers based on the pigment color. Red tattoos are the most difficult to treat with laser. About Tattoo Removal Treatments

Topical anesthetic creams are usually applied approximately an hour before the treatment. Some patients prefer to have a local anesthetic injected into the tattoo prior to laser therapy. Pinpoint bleeding, crusting and occasional blistering can be associated with the procedure. Pulses of laser energy are directed onto the tattoo, breaking up the pigment. Over the next few weeks, the body’s scavenger cells remove pigment residues.

How PicoSure Laser Tattoo Removal Works

Tattoo Removal with PicoSure

PicoSure is the world’s first safe and effective picosecond aesthetic and tattoo removal laser. This breakthrough in laser technology delivers ultra-short pulse bursts of energy to the skin in trillionths of a second, which is 100 times shorter than nanosecond technology available in most lasers, enabling unmatched photomechanical impact for better clearance with fewer treatments.

Number of Treatments

More than one treatment, (each treatment actually only takes minutes), is usually needed to remove an entire tattoo — the number of sessions depends on the amount and type of ink used and how deeply it was injected. Four to six-week intervals between sessions are required to allow pigment residue to be absorbed by the body. Anywhere from 6 to more than 10 treatments may be necessary to achieve maximum lightening. Patients must not be tan during their treatment sessions. Following treatment, wound care and sun protection of the treated area is necessary. A change in the color of the treated area is likely and may be permanent. If the area gets infected, there is a risk of a scar.
